Output fdaf98d17519055fc3f24810d40a387b7551b5486bbf9315c7cb0c7f4a66b017:48

value
5170130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bb53cb02f6c23840bdfa2387d6fe774b5c22c01 OP_EQUAL
address
3JoXPzFn5yp5NPRXzrWkymJUaXkYbgeKBs
transaction
fdaf98d17519055fc3f24810d40a387b7551b5486bbf9315c7cb0c7f4a66b017
confirmations
383771
spent
true